Decoupling of Tensor factors in Cross Product and Braided Tensor Product Algebras
Gaetano Fiore
math.QAarXiv:math/0212320
Abstract
We briefly review and illustrate our procedure to 'decouple' by transformation of generators: either a Hopf algebra H from a H-module algebra A1 in their cross-product A1 > H; or two (or more) H-module algebras A1,A2. These transformations are based on the existence of an algebra map A1 > H A1.
